Output dc7586d750fbcf5fcb402e5ee25a61115bc236e6f3e5ba2f86967bc6b97f898f:0

value
353000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44033196862d13b638f9996fb0862a1289e73381 OP_EQUALVERIFY OP_CHECKSIG
address
17CcmwvCMv7fEwUmhU2XMQhYGyFaE3dJy7
transaction
dc7586d750fbcf5fcb402e5ee25a61115bc236e6f3e5ba2f86967bc6b97f898f
confirmations
437047
spent
true